Webnumber of flights with the two aircraft to 436. Reverse airflow—forward-swept wing vs. aft swept wing. On the forward-swept wing, ailerons remained unstalled at high angles of attack because the air over the forward swept wing tended to flow inward toward the root of the wing rather than outward toward the wing tip as on an aft-swept wing. http://www.ae.utexas.edu/courses/ase333t/past_projects/04spring/FSW%20Airfoils%20Inc/fsw.htm

WebAug 30, 2024 · The low wing configuration simply means that the wings are mounted low on the body of the plane, below the middle of it. This configuration is beneficial to pilots because it typically offers the best overall visibility since the pilots will be able to see left, right, forward, and up with unencumbered vision.
